Albany Airport called financially unsustainable

When you look at the money, the future of Albany’s small general aviation airport looks bleak. The operation is financially unsustainable, a team of consultants has found.

On Dec. 18 the city’s Airport Advisory Commission got a preliminary report from ECOnorthwest, the consulting firm the city council hired last May at a cost of $113,469.

Among their conclusions so far is that the airport has a limited role in Oregon aviation, that the operation is in an “unsustainable financial position,” and that demand for expanded aviation use is uncertain…
